Overview of Audio File Converters
Audio file converters play a crucial role in managing various audio formats. They transform files, enabling easy playback across different devices. Common conversions include changing .wav files to .mp3, allowing seamless integration with smartphones, tablets, and computers.
Software options for audio file conversion abound. Some converters provide online services, while others require installation on a device. Each type offers unique features, catering to diverse user needs.
Many converters support multiple formats beyond .wav and .mp3, such as .aac, .flac, and .ogg. Their versatility ensures compatibility with various audio players and editing software.
Users appreciate converter applications for their simplicity and efficiency. Drag-and-drop interfaces often streamline the conversion process. Furthermore, batch conversion features save time by allowing users to convert multiple files simultaneously.
Quality preservation remains a priority when selecting audio file converters. High-quality converters minimize the degradation of sound, making it essential to choose reliable software.
Security also matters. Trustworthy converters maintain user privacy and protect files from unauthorized access.
Audio file converters simplify the process of managing audio files. They enhance user experience by enabling compatibility across devices and formats while maintaining sound quality.
Types of Audio File Converters

Audio file converters come in various forms, each catering to specific user needs and preferences. Users can choose from online services, desktop applications, and mobile apps for seamless audio file management.
Online Converters
Online audio converters allow quick conversions without any software installation. These tools often support numerous formats, enabling users to convert files like .aac, .flac, and .ogg directly in their web browsers. Accessibility holds significant advantages, as users can convert files from any device with internet access. Many online converters offer batch processing capabilities, helping users save time when converting multiple files simultaneously. While convenience is a highlight, users must verify the security and privacy protocols of these platforms to ensure safe file handling.
Desktop Converters
Desktop audio converters provide robust functionality for users seeking more advanced features. These applications typically support a wider range of formats and may include options for editing audio files before conversion. Many desktop converters feature intuitive interfaces, simplifying the process of managing audio files. Users often appreciate the reliability of offline use, which eliminates concerns about internet connectivity during file processing. High-quality converters ensure minimal sound degradation, maintaining the integrity of the audio throughout the conversion process.
Mobile App Converters
Mobile app converters allow quick audio file management on-the-go. Users can easily install these applications on their smartphones or tablets, making conversions accessible anytime, anywhere. Many apps offer a user-friendly interface, enabling straightforward file selection and conversion. Batch conversion features often exist, providing efficiency for users managing numerous audio files. Understanding the importance of sound quality, many mobile apps prioritize maintaining audio fidelity during conversions. Security remains a crucial aspect, ensuring that users’ data and privacy are protected while using these mobile solutions.

Benefits of Using Audio File Converters
Audio file converters offer various benefits that enhance the user experience. Users find value in their ability to simplify audio file management.
File Size Reduction
Reducing file size saves storage space. Smaller audio files consume less device memory, allowing users to store more content. This reduction occurs without significant loss of audio quality. Users can also share files more easily due to decreased transfer times. For example, converting a large .wav file to .mp3 can shrink its size substantially, making quick sharing seamless. Many audio converters provide options to adjust the bit rate, offering tailored file sizes based on user needs.
Format Compatibility
Audio file converters provide significant format compatibility. Supporting numerous file types ensures users can play audio across various devices. For instance, converters often handle .wav, .mp3, .aac, .flac, and .ogg formats. This breadth allows users to access their favorite tracks on different devices like smartphones and tablets. Converting files to popular formats benefits compatibility with streaming services and media players. This feature ensures that users enjoy their audio without being restricted by format limitations.
Quality Preservation
Maintaining sound quality remains a priority when selecting audio converters. High-quality converters minimize degradation during file conversion. Preservation techniques help retain clarity, ensuring that converted files sound as good as the originals. Some converters even allow users to choose settings that enhance playback quality. Additionally, using reliable software helps secure optimal audio performance. For instance, a top-rated converter might offer lossless formats that retain the integrity of the sound, making it ideal for audiophiles.
